Tired of your VR sword flying away during a big swing? You're in the middle of a great fight, and suddenly your weapon glitches. A VR sword attachment feels like the solution.

A VR sword attachment provides a solid physical lock, stopping the controller from slipping during wide swings. It does not fix the Meta Quest's internal tracking limitations. Your controller can still lose tracking if it moves too fast or goes outside the headset's camera view.

Does tracking during swings affect beginners and experienced users in the same way?

You're a VR veteran who knows how to move, but your sword still glitches. It's frustrating when your skill can't overcome a hardware limit. Experience doesn't always solve tracking problems.

No, tracking issues affect users differently. Experienced players often use faster, more optimized swings that can exceed the Quest's tracking speed, causing glitches. Beginners tend to make slower, broader arm movements that are easier for the cameras to follow, but they struggle more with the accessory's weight.

A beginner struggles with a VR sword attachment while an experienced user executes a fast, precise swing in a game.

As a long-time Beat Saber player, my movements are trained for speed and precision, mostly from the wrist. When I strapped the VR sword on to play Battle Talent, my muscle memory was a problem. I wanted to flick the controller, but the game and the accessory demanded big, powerful swings from the shoulder. This created a controller mismatch between my expectation and the physical reality. An experienced player tries to be efficient. We push the limits. This is exactly where the Quest s inside-out tracking can fail. The cameras on the headset just can't keep up if the controller moves too fast. A beginner, on the other hand, usually moves their whole arm in a slower, wider arc. This motion is much easier for the headset to track. Their challenge is not tracking loss but adapting to the new weight and balance of the longer controller.

User Experience Comparison

Aspect Beginner User Experienced User
Swing Style Slow, wide arm swings Fast, efficient, often wrist-based
Main Challenge Adapting to weight and balance Controller mismatch and tracking speed limits
Tracking Sensitivity Less prone to tracking loss More likely to experience tracking glitches
Fatigue High, due to inefficient movement High, due to added weight on fast swings

What should be measured before claiming VR Sword fixes tracking during swings?

A product promises to "fix" tracking. You buy it, hoping for a solution, but the glitches continue. You need a clear way to test these claims for yourself to avoid disappointment.

To validate such claims, you must measure objective data. This includes checking the controller's positional accuracy at various swing speeds, counting the frequency of tracking glitches, and looking for rotational drift. Subjective feeling isn't enough; you need concrete proof of performance improvement.

Visual data overlay showing the tracking path of a VR controller during a fast swing, highlighting potential measurement points.

My testing process was simple but revealing. The first thing I checked was the physical connection. Does the controller rattle or shift inside the sword handle? In this case, it was locked in tight. So, the accessory does fix the problem of the controller physically slipping in your hand. That's a pass. But the claim of fixing tracking is about software and sensors, not just plastic. The VR sword has no electronics. It fully depends on the Quest 3 controller's own tracking system.

This led to my failure case. I went into Battle Talent and swung the sword as fast as I could. The controller still flew away. The glitch happened every time my swing was too fast or when my hand went just outside the view of the headset's cameras. This proves the accessory cannot fix the fundamental limitations of inside-out tracking. A proper test would need special software to log the controller's 3D position frame by frame. We could then compare the logged path to the real-world path. Without that tool, we have to rely on careful observation, and my observation is clear: the accessory helps with grip, not with tracking speed.

Is kids' play value versus safety supervision acceptable for Beat Saber players?

The VR sword looks like a cool toy, perfect for kids. But one excited swing could easily hit a wall, a pet, or another person. Is the added fun worth the increased risk?

For most Beat Saber players, the trade-off is not worth it. The game's quick wrist movements make the long, heavy attachment feel clumsy and slow. The added length greatly increases the risk of hitting something, making the accessory impractical and unsafe for that style of play.

A child enthusiastically swinging a VR sword accessory in a living room, with a cautious parent supervising from nearby.

Let's be honest: this accessory feels like a toy. And that's not necessarily a bad thing. For a child playing a fantasy adventure game, the added weight and length can make the experience incredibly immersive. It boosts the "play value" because it makes them feel like they are holding a real sword. The problem is that it also makes the controller a real hazard. The standard controller boundary is no longer accurate. I have a decent-sized playspace, and I still came close to hitting my furniture several times. For a child, who is less aware of their surroundings, constant supervision is an absolute must.

As someone who primarily plays Beat Saber, I found the attachment to be a complete downgrade. It ruined my game. The weight threw off my timing, and the length made my precise wrist flicks impossible. It felt like trying to write with a broomstick. For this game, there is no added play value, only added risk. The accessory is simply not designed for high-speed, precision-based rhythm games. The balance between fun and safety is completely skewed toward unacceptable risk for this specific use case.

You want that epic sword-fighting feel in Battle Talent. This accessory seems like the perfect tool for the job. But you need to know if it's a serious upgrade or just a toy.

Yes. This accessory is best for Battle Talent players who prioritize immersion over competitive performance. Users must accept its toy-like qualities, have a large, clear playspace, and understand the increased safety risks involved. For players focused on high scores or with limited space, it's not a good fit.

A VR gamer in a spacious, clear room dual-wielding VR sword attachments for an immersive experience in a melee game.

After trying the VR sword in different games, my final verdict is very specific. In Beat Saber, it was a definite no. The controller mismatch and fatigue made it unplayable for me. It felt annoying and counterproductive. However, my experience in Battle Talent was the complete opposite. Swinging the weighted, longer handle felt fantastic. It made parrying and attacking feel more realistic and satisfying. Dual-wielding two of them was tiring but incredibly fun. The immersion was a solid 10 out of 10.

But that recommendation comes with big warnings. The tracking issues did not disappear. Fast, wild swings still caused my virtual sword to glitch out. And the safety concern is real. I had to be hyper-aware of my surroundings. So, who should buy this? You should buy it if you play melee games like Battle Talent, you want to feel more immersed, and you have a very large, safe area to play in. You must accept that you are buying it for the fun, the "play value," not for a competitive edge. If you are a competitive player or have a small room, you should skip this accessory.
